On June 6, 1953, brothers Larry and Jack Mitchell opened Mitchell's Ice Cream at San Jose Avenue and 29th Street in San Francisco. Larry and Jack were no strangers to the dairy business, as the family owned and operated a small dairy farm in San Francisco in the late 1800's.
Our store began as a neighborhood ice cream shop, but it wasn't long before restaurants and cafes began requesting our ice cream and sorbets for their menus. Over the years, we've gained renown not only for manufacturing super premium gourmet ice cream, but also for making exotic tropical flavors.
Mitchell's is still owned and operated by the Mitchell family today. Because of our dedication to creating the very best ice cream, we were voted "Best Ice Cream Parlor" by the San Francisco Bay Guardian from 1996 through 2004, "Best Ice Cream" by the San Francisco Weekly from 2001 through 2004, and "Best Ice Cream" by CitySearch.com in 2001, 2002 and 2004. We have won over 50 gold, silver and bronze ribbons, as well as 2 gold medallions at California State Fairs.
